What is Steel's background, ie. past jobs, training, etc?

He was borne to a lessor noble family (ie, not the wealthiest, but that doesn't mean they weren't really nice folks) in Canterlot and was raised there. Public school, not private. Got his cutie mark by saving a classmate from a manticore during a school field trip. This inspired him to attend the Royal Guard Academy, right down to the Royal Guard training program. He graduated with full marks, and offers to work for both the Royal and Night Guard ... but he turned them both down because he wanted something more active. With his scores, it wasn't hard to secure a job as a bodyguard for an industrialist, a job that quickly took him outside Equestria and to all sorts of dangerous places.

He jumped from job to job for a while, hiring out his services as needed, spending more and more time outside Equestria but still coming back from time to time. Roughly twenty years before Rise, he was hired to serve as a soldier-for-hire in the Regency wars, where he met Primetail and assisted his faction in replacing the current king and ruling clan.

After the Regency Wars were over, he traveled more, first around the Griffon Empire (where he became a Blademaster), and then around the world at large, still working as a bodyguard before eventually growing tired and deciding to retire while at the peak of his game. He bought a small cottage in Canterville, settled his debts, and decided to live out the rest of his days (or at least a good amount of time) near his family.

How did this particular pony epic get started? I'm fairly sure you didn't just wake up one morning with a new and fully formed idea in your head and a burning desire to write it into reality. Fairly sure. What was this fic idea's genesis?

Oddly enough, a game idea. This was way back when I was getting into the fandom, and I was thinking about how much fun it would be to make a pony RPG. Of course, I thought, if you wanted to go for something like FFVI, you'd need a large cast of characters, and I started thinking about how you could supplement the mane six (or perhaps step outside them entirely). That got me thinking about guards, which in turn got me thinking about an old, retired Guardpony who would likely teach your crew new moves, but of course he'd need an explanation for why he was in possession of all this combat prowess, so I started thinking of his story ... and very quickly realized that his story was the real story, and it'd make a better book than a game.

At the same time, I was just starting to get into writing for publishing and switching careers to that, and I figured that writing this story I was coming up with would be both great practice for some of the other stuff I wanted to write as well as a chance to give back to the community. So I formulated this big, epic-plot (as I'd never written an epic and wanted to practice that), and sat down and started writing.

How do pony ages work, ie. life expectancy?

It varies. Someone who takes good care of themselves can expect to live to be well over 100, but that's not always the case. Some die in their 60s or 70s. On average, most make it into their 80s or 90s, but start feeling it in their 60s or 70s.

What kind of technology does Equstria, and even the world in general, have?

It's kind of a mixed bag. What you've seen in TDG is pretty accurate. With magic acting as a stand-in for some tech, they're ahead of what one would think, but in other ways they're almost behind. They're roughly around the early 1900s by our standards, but that isn't exactly accurate, as they do advance/not advance in different areas based on what they discover and need. For example, we know they have movie theaters ... as well as magical holograms. They have portable music players ... but based on records, not CDs or tapes. The most telling thing would be to say that both in the show and TDGS, they're in the middle of an industrial boom, which is about to become a giant leap forward into a new technical era (much like computers jumped us forward).

What's the dominant power (country) in the world?

Depends on who you ask. Most would agree that it's Equestria if you consider diplomatic, political, or economic power the primary, but the Griffon Empire is definitely the world's leader in military power (with the Minotaur nation close behind thanks to their tech advantage). The Griffon Empire is also a massive exporter, and pretty much on economic parity with Equestria. Other countries don't cover quite so much territory, but still carry political influence and favor, as well as economic power in their own right.

Again, though, since Equestria has control over the sun, the moon, and thereby the tides, they've got a lot of influence in political spheres, and tend to be host to most diplomatic meetings. Plus, since two immortals run Equestria, those meetings are, more often than not, almost always good for something!

What are dragons like in The Dusk Guard Saga? Author headcanon tends to vary, so I'd like your view on the mythical species, and how their existence is connected to other sapients, and the rest of the world.

They're very standoffish, isolated, and individualistic, mostly tending to keep to themselves. Being long-lived (several hundred years) they tend to be a bit snobbish and disinterested in the affairs of other nations, and stick to their own dealings. Even then, they aren't that social with one another, apart from the great migration each year, and as such they could be considered the most undeveloped of nations since they aren't even that developed. Most of them are content to live in their caves and amass hordes of priceless metals and gems and spend their hours relaxing or asleep. This leads to numerous dangerous forays into dragon territory in pursuit of rare materials, and only time will tell how long they'll be able to maintain their current lifestyle.

Speaking of interlopers on their territory, dragons are known to wander. An international agreement between most nations and a representative of the dragon race agrees that dragons who wander outside of the official territory are at the mercy of their behavior and the nation whose borders they find themselves within (save during the migrations). Likewise, those who wander into dragon territory are at the mercy of the dragons. Some wandering dragons can be found peacefully dozing away in strange places, while others find themselves beset upon by military forces looking to drive them away ... especially if they haven't played nice.

Culturally, a lot of them still see themselves as "better" than most other beings and above most rules or laws, something that could lead to a head as more and more countries advance into the modern age.
